Lý Quân

Definition
  1. Proper Noun:
    • Li Jun: A Chinese-derived name, often used in historical or literary contexts. It is not a standard Vietnamese word with a standalone lexical meaning. Its significance depends entirely on the specific character or context in which it is used.
Usage Notes
  • Context-Dependent Meaning: " Quân" is a personal name. Its meaning cannot be defined without specific context. It may refer to a specific historical figure, a character in a story, or be used as a given name and surname combination.
  • Cultural Note: In Vietnamese, "" is a common family name and "Quân" is a common given name meaning "army" or "ruler." Together, they form a full name.
